Table 3. Cancer risk following organ transplantation in Sweden 1970–1997.
Cancer site (ICD-7) | Observed no. cases | SIR | 95% CI |
---|---|---|---|
Non-kidney transplants SIR for selected sites | |||
Lip (140) | 1 | 24.8 | 0.6–138.6 |
Stomach (151) | 3 | 12.0 | 2.4–35.0 |
Colon (153) | 0 | 0 | 0.0–5.8 |
Rectal (154) | 2 | 4.5 | 0.5–16.2 |
Kidney (180) | 0 | 0 | 0.0–11.2 |
Nonmelanoma skin cancer (191) | 11 | 34.0 | 17.0–60.6 |
Non-Hodgkin's lymphoma (200, 204, 204.1) | 18 | 37.3 | 22.1–59.1 |
All cancers | 53 | 4.94 | 3.7–6.4 |
Kidney transplants SIR for selected sites | |||
Lip (140) | 39 | 54.8 | 39.0–74.9 |
Stomach (151) | 9 | 1.8 | 0.8–3.4 |
Colon (153) | 25 | 2.4 | 1.5–3.5 |
Rectal (154) | 12 | 1.7 | 0.9–3.0 |
Kidney (180) | 28 | 5.2 | 3.4–7.5 |
Nonmelanoma skin cancer (191) | 267 | 57.7 | 51.0–65.1 |
Non-Hodgkin's lymphoma (200, 204, 204.1) | 27 | 3.8 | 2.5–5.6 |
All cancers | 639 | 3.9 | 3.6–4.2 |
Observed number of cases, SIR (SIR) and 95% confidence intervals (CI) by cancer site, type and transplanted organ.
